Key Considerations Before Buying
- Consider the volume and type of odours you need to address. If your fridge holds strong-smelling foods like fish or cheese, a high-capacity deodoriser with proven absorption materials is essential, not just a passive carbon bag.
- Evaluate the lifespan and maintenance. This product's 10-year claim means no monthly replacements, but verify if it requires reactivation (e.g., sun drying) or if it truly works continuously without upkeep.
- Think about placement and coverage. For larger refrigerators or RV use, check dimensions and whether the deodoriser can be positioned to circulate air effectively, rather than just sitting in one corner.
What Our Analysts Recommend
Look for deodorisers that specify the active ingredient (e.g., activated carbon, zeolite) and its surface area, as higher porosity typically means better odour capture. Also, check for certifications or lab test results that substantiate performance claims, and read user feedback on how quickly it neutralises smells after installation.

Common Issues
A common issue is that many deodorisers, especially charcoal bags, lose effectiveness after a few months and need frequent replacement or sun-charging, which many users forget. Others may mask odours rather than eliminate them, or fail to handle persistent smells in sealed, humid environments.
Quality Indicators
High-quality deodorisers often feature high-density activated carbon or zeolite, a durable casing that allows airflow, and clear instructions for activation and lifespan. Positive reviews that mention specific odour challenges (e.g., after a power outage) and successful resolution are strong indicators of effectiveness.
